CVE-2026-45914

Kernel crash via ibmpex sysfs teardown race

Published May 27, 2026 · Updated May 27, 2026

A race condition in the Linux kernel ibmpex hwmon driver allows local users to crash the kernel through a concurrent sysfs sensor read. During device removal, teardown clears driver data before removing sensor attributes, while ibmpex_show_sensor() dereferences the cleared pointer without a NULL check. Exploitation requires the ibmpex driver and a sensor-file read to overlap device teardown, resulting in a local service interrupt.
